All I know is that if they pick Justin, we'll be looking at a Conservative majority next election.
Personally, I think Bob Rae would be a disaster too. I know they think that they'll curry favour with NDP voters, but they'll also lose a lot of moderate voters.
Problem with Ignatieff is that he's too much of an academic. The political situation in Canada now is not so much a battle of ideas, as much as some people would like it to be, it's a contest for strong competent leadership and practical results. They need to find someone who's charismatic but who also has lots of practical experience and isn't such an idealist.
Fresh policies and ideas, yes, sure, those are nice, but more than anything else they need a leader. I genuinely hope they do find someone because a strong moderate-to-left party would force Harper to take a few more risks with his own career.

You know, just going back over the list of past prime ministers - Harper, Martin, Chretien, Mulroney, Trudeau... Canadian leadership has been almost catastrophic for the past 30 or so years.
I know it's naively optimistic to the point of absurdity, but I really wish that since the Liberals have nothing to lose anyway, that they would take their time searching and try to find another leader like Pearson, who defined peacekeeping as something other than pacifism and spoke out against Quebec separatism.
At the very least, they could broaden their search outside of Quebec. Fuck, last time they had an "English" candidate was - yep - Pearson.
Between Rae and Ignatieff, I guess I'd have to go with Ignatieff too, but they're both terrible choices.
